You need to search for DRY Wood Pellets at approximately 4-10 % DRYNESS or dryer to burn well in a pellet stove. Most wood pellet bags come in air-tight plastic bags ranging 4-10% Moisture content. Some warehouses have high humidity and moisture, and if the bags are not air-tight sealed, moisture will creep in. Also your supplier may inadvertenly slip you some WET Wood Pellets and you should have a way of monitoring that. Note that your pellet Stove, Furnace or Boiler will run much better with 4-10% (or less) DRY Wood Pellets and the dryer the wood pellets, the higher your BTU/Hr output. High moisture wood pellets can become impacted and jam the auger and/or auger shaft. High moisture wood pellets will crush into a dough-like putty and crate JAMS galore! High moisture wood pellets can also cause clinkers in the fire pot, a characteristic normally indentified only with corn-burning. . Dry wood pellets can help eliminate costly agitator and auger repair, burn higher BTU output, and save you money in the long run.
